MICROSOFT seems to be planning an August release for Vista, despite the fact that it claims that it will not hit the shops until December 2006.
Business Week has received a copy of the internal blog of Vole executive Chris Jones,which said that he will not get his bonus if Vista is not shipped with high quality and with the 'soul intact' by August 31st, 2006.
This means that Vole clearly wants the OS out in time for people to put the operating system under their Crimbo trees. Although we are not sure how much of a Christmas rush there will be for operating systems.
Although it would be better than socks, Vista doesn't really come with that figgy pudding feel for Yuletide gifts.
Jones, who is Corporate Vice President, Windows Core Operating System Program Management, said that if he doesn't make the deadline then it will be a miserable Christmas for him and his family, with no turkey for Tiny Tim.
